How they compare

Romania currently reports 160.05 Index against 137.82 Index in Croatia, a difference of 22.23 Index.

That makes Romania's figure about 1.2 times Croatia's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Croatia ahead.

Croatia ranks 2nd and Romania ranks 2nd of 2 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Croatia averaged higher in 3 and Romania in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Croatia Romania Difference Ahead
1990s 66.37 Index 19.22 Index 47.15 Index Croatia
2000s 79.71 Index 59.22 Index 20.49 Index Croatia
2010s 99.05 Index 98.71 Index 0.3356 Index Croatia
2020s 120.46 Index 134.42 Index 13.96 Index Romania

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

This dataset contains statistics on Harmonised Indices of Consumer Prices (HICPs) by ECOICOP divisions and their associated weights. HICPs are published by Eurostat, the statistical office of the European Union and are calculated according to a harmonised approach and a single set of definitions in order to give comparable measures of inflation in the euro area, the European Union, the European Economic Area and for other countries.
